0
1995-11-02
A 1995 Hong Kong thriller.
Watch Trailer
Released
Runtime
86
Director
Yu Chi Lien
Budget
$0
Revenue
Genres
Action
Drama
Thriller
Language
广州话 / 廣州話
Production